VIDI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

10 of the 3,455 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vident International Equity Strategy (VIDI)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$710M — down 2.7% from $730M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 4 funds opened new VIDI posit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 2 added to existing stakes and 4 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Ronald Blue & Co, adding an estimated $21M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, cutting an estimated $3.21M.
